The BQ2040SN-C408 from Texas Instruments is a gas gauge IC with an SMBus interface, intended for battery-pack or in-system installation to maintain an accurate record of available battery charge. It directly supports capacity monitoring for NiCd, NiMH, and Li-Ion battery chemistries.
This IC utilizes the System Management Bus v1.0 (SMBus) protocol and supports Smart Battery Data (SBData) commands, including charge control functions. Battery state-of-charge, remaining capacity, and chemistry are available over the serial link. It can drive a four-segment LED display for remaining capacity indication in 25% increments.
The BQ2040SN-C408 operates from a 3.0V to 6.5V supply voltage and has an operating temperature range of 0°C to 70°C. It is housed in a 16-pin SOIC package and is designed for surface mount integration. The device monitors charge FET in Li-Ion pack protection circuits and supports SBS v1.0 data set and a two-wire interface.
